News Talk 1110 & 99.3 WBT has announced that it will host a debate between candidates in the Republican Primary race for the North Carolina 8th Congressional District seat.  The Republican Primary will take place on March 5, 2024, and will determine which Republican candidate will represent the party in the NC 8th District general election on November 5, 2024.

WBT’s debate will take place on Wednesday, January 31, 2024, at Wingate University’s Batte Fine Arts Center.  Invitations have been sent to the six registered candidates for the Primary: Allan BaucomJohn R. Bradford IIIDon BrownLeigh BrownMark Harris, and Chris Maples.  A deadline of Sunday, January 21, 2024, has been set for the candidates to accept the invitation to participate in the debate.

Moderated by WBT’s Bo Thompson and Beth Troutman, hosts of Good Morning BT (6:00 AM – 10:00 AM), the debate will feature questions for the candidates presented by WBT’s Vince Coakley (10:00 AM – 12:00 PM), Pete Kaliner (12:00 PM – 3:00 PM), Brett Winterble (3:00 PM – 7:00 PM), Brett Jensen (7:00 PM – 8:00 PM), and Mark Garrison (News Director & Morning Anchor).

The event will include a 30-minute show hosted by Thompson and Troutman beginning at 7 PM, with the 90-minute debate beginning at 7:30 PM.  The entire program will be broadcast live on WBT and will be commercial-free.
